When planning a futon and desk layout, consider the surface area and available square footage. Mid Room Desk Setup Ideas For Small Home Offices
A compact desk with a minimalist design can work well in a small room, leaving ample space for the futon and a few decorations. Conversely, a larger room can accommodate a spacious desk setup, such as a built-in desk with plenty of storage space. Using a console table or a narrow desk with a sleek design can help to separate the work and relaxation areas without obstructing the space. Effective lighting is another crucial aspect to consider when planning a futon and desk layout.
Positioning a floor lamp near the futon can create a cozy ambiance, while under-desk lighting can help to reduce glare and eye strain when working on the computer.
